How they compare

Belgium currently reports 93.52 against 79.54 in Northern Europe, a difference of 13.98.

That makes Belgium's figure about 1.2 times Northern Europe's.

Across all 23 years both countries report, Belgium has been ahead every year.

Belgium ranks 8th and Northern Europe ranks 5th of 188 countries.

Belgium has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Belgium Northern Europe Difference Ahead
2000s 80.68 65.16 15.52 Belgium
2010s 82.24 69.45 12.79 Belgium
2020s 90.37 76.88 13.49 Belgium

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Imputed observations are not based on national data, are subject to high uncertainty and should not be used for country comparisons or rankings. This series is based on the 13th ICLS definitions. This measure of labour productivity is calculated using data on GDP (in constant 2021 international dollars at PPP) derived from the World Development Indicators database of the World Bank.
